Because of licensing issues with real-world car manufacturers and music tracks, the original 2005 version is not available on modern digital storefronts like Steam or EA App. This digital scarcity has elevated the original physical and archived PC copies to an exclusive, holy-grail status among racing enthusiasts.

Modders have upscaled the road textures, skyboxes, and car models, stripping away the heavily saturated "yellow filter" of the original graphics to reveal a crisp, modern aesthetic.

Need for Speed: Most Wanted 2005 PC puts players in the driver's seat of high-performance cars, tasked with evading the police and taking down rival racers on the streets of Rockport City. You cannot talk about Need for Speed: Most Wanted without praising its soundtrack. The game features an explosive mix of nu-metal, hard rock, hip-hop, and electronic music that perfectly encapsulates the mid-2000s subculture.
